The Zhang He 张鹤

The Zhang He 张鹤

Paul Peng
Zhang He was a native of Rui'an, Zhejiang Province during the Qing Dynasty. His courtesy name was Jingxiang.

He was officially registered as a Taoist priest at Yuqing Guan (Jade Clear Temple) in Shanghai.
He excelled in poetry and prose, was skilled in painting landscapes, and was particularly renowned in the Taoist community for his guqin (ancient zither) playing.

In the third year of the Tongzhi reign (1864), he compiled Qinxue Rumen (Introduction to Guqin Studies), which included gongche notation (a traditional Chinese musical notation), and the sheet music remains popular to this day.
